改性淀粉絮凝剂具有绿色、无毒、价廉、易于生物降解、来源广泛等特点。离子化改性淀粉絮凝剂主要包括阴离子型改性淀粉絮凝剂、阳离子型改性淀粉絮凝剂、两性淀粉絮凝剂以及非离子型改性淀粉絮凝剂等。这几种不同类型的改性淀粉絮凝剂在不同类型的废水处理中取得了明显的效果。 相似文献

天然淀粉改性絮凝剂研究与应用概况 总被引:7,自引:0,他引:7
天然淀粉及其改性絮凝剂是一种无毒、可生物降解的绿色化学品.本文介绍了淀粉改性的研究概况,并重点综述了淀粉絮凝剂改性途径及其在水处理和其它领域的应用. 相似文献

Starch is a known carbohydrate in which, regardless of its origin, two polysaccharides are found namely amylose and amylopectin. By insertion of a cationic moiety to the backbone of starch, a modified cationic starch can be developed which can be used as flocculant. Various grades of cationic starches were developed to optimize the best performing flocculant. The base polysaccharide, starch and the best performing cationic starch i.e., Cat St3 (which have been confirmed from flocculation characteristics and intrinsic viscosity measurement) have been characterized by various characterization techniques such as determination of molecular weight, elemental analysis, FTIR spectroscopy, intrinsic viscosity measurement, thermal analysis, etc. From the characterization, it could be concluded that there was a substantial incorporation of cationic moiety onto the backbone of starch. The flocculation efficacy of these cationized starches was compared with each other and with some of the commercial flocculants available in national and international market in manganese ore suspensions. © 2008 Wiley Periodicals, Inc.
